Photo of Timothy Bryant

Timothy Bryant

CEO/General Manager

Timothy (Tim) Bryant began his career as PWC’s 10th CEO/General Manager on August 14, 2023.

Bryant, who brings over 25 years of utility experience to PWC, came to Fayetteville from Florida Power and Light Company (FPL) where he held numerous leadership roles since 2008. FPL is the largest electric utility in the United States, serving an estimated 12.5 million people in the state of Florida.  FPL is a subsidiary of NextEra Energy, Inc., the world’s largest developer and operator of renewable energy generated from the wind and sun.

Bryant most recently served as Director of External Affairs for FPL where he worked as a liaison between FPL and its stakeholders in the development of Power Generation, Transmission, Distribution, Economic Development, Community Relations, and Environmental projects across Florida.   A former power plant manager, Bryant was instrumental in the operations and maintenance of three FPL Energy Centers.  He also served as General Manager of Wind Central Maintenance team that led the restoration of wind turbine fleets across North American before moving into External Affairs.

Before NextEra Energy, he worked for Southern Company in Birmingham, Alabama, where he led a multi-discipline engineering team in designing simple-cycle and combined-cycle power generation facilities and environmental control systems.  A native of Goldsboro, North Carolina, Bryant began his utility career in 1997 with power generation engineering roles with Black & Veatch Corporation.

Bryant is a Professional Engineer and a graduate of North Carolina State University with a degree in Mechanical Engineering and earned an MBA from Baker University (Baldwin, KS) .  In addition to his utility career,  Bryant is a former commissioned officer in the U.S. Army National Guard where he served over 12 years in Kansas and North Carolina.

Photo of Rhonda Haskins, CPA

Rhonda Haskins, CPA

Chief Financial Officer

Rhonda Haskins was appointed Chief Financial Officer in June 2018 after serving in various financial roles at PWC for 24 years.  Prior to her CFO appointment, she served as the Director of Financial Planning for 17 years.  She joined PWC in 1994 after practicing public accounting with Cherry Bekaert, LLC, and has over 30 years of governmental accounting, auditing and financial management experience.     

While with Cherry Bekaert, she led audit teams and financial statement preparation for cities, utilities, schools and construction companies.  She holds both the North Carolina Certified Public Accountant and Certified Global Management Accountant certifications.  She received her Bachelor of Business Administration Degree with a concentration in Accounting from Campbell University and is a member of the NC Association of CPAs and the American Institute of CPAs.

Rhonda is active in her community and professional organizations.  She is a past Treasurer of the United Way of Cumberland County and an active member of the American Public Power Association (past Chair to the Accounting, Finance and Internal Section Committee), the National and State Government Finance Officers Associations, and serves as an active member of a Steering Committee for the NC Women in Public Finance.  Her more recent and current local community initiatives are the Women’s Giving Circle, NetWorth, Treasurer of the Fayetteville Symphony Orchestra Board, and Treasurer of the Cool Spring District Board.
